I've been experimenting the last couple of nights with the U-boat War Ace (Wolfpack) mod and the various Sergbuto mods it requires to make it work. It's too early to tell much about that new mod yet (only real thing I noticed so far was a couple of ships sinking in my home port and the hydrophone contact lines on my map are so precise they make it too easy to plot perfect attack runs in dense fog).

BUT, the weird thing was that after surfacing from that attack and speeding off for a while, the weather changed and I could see the horizon, and it is really tilted - higher on the right side of my screen than on the left side, and by quite a bit. I thought at first my ship might have been damaged and be listing to starboard or something, but no damage was indicated and, even weirder, the horizon is tilted the same direction and amount as I rotate and look all around the compass - see the picture below for screen shot (note horizon tilt along very top edge of the picture):

Well, this tilt effect did go away after I reloaded the game ( :D )

You can also "ALT+TAB" a couple of times... minimizing SH3 and re-expanding it... Often just doing that will re-set the camera.

It's been an issue since before the new camera mods. "ie: the bouncing camera"

I also get a partial "sound loss" issue with cameras that goes away when I pop back into the control room for a moment. It usually only affects one layer of sound.
